It is crucial to examine window frames regularly for signs of damage and rot. They may be damaged by fungi that eat wood or they could sag if the wood inside is beginning to rot. This could allow water to enter the home and cause further damage. Window experts repair damaged frames or sashes, and even add weather stripping to stop drafts. They can also replace the caulking on your window and rehang it to increase its energy efficiency.

Another issue that is common is condensation between the window panes. the window doctor can be a sign that the seal between the panes is broken or the structural integrity of your double-pane window has been damaged. Window experts can repair damaged seals and clean the glass to restore the window’s functionality. This can reduce the cost of energy.

You might need to replace your sash in the event that you have an old window. This is the part that holds the window in place. It is a difficult task to do on your own. Window doctors have the skills and tools to replace sash including special glues and tools for cutting glass. They also repair and put in wooden window frames.

A squeegee can be a good choice, as it removes moisture from the window without leaving streaks. Microfiber cloths are a good option, as they are absorbent and can be used on all kinds of windows. They are also light and easy to maneuver, making them a great choice for high or hard-to-reach windows.

For tougher gunk scrub pads are the best choice. They are a great way to get rid of insects, stains, bird poop, and construction debris from windows. You can choose from a variety of sizes to suit your requirements.

Window repair is a crucial component of the job of any window specialist since it involves patching holes in windows and fixing damaged frames. In addition to replacing damaged windows window repair also entails repairing locks that are stuck, broken tilt latches, as well as other window components. These tasks require specific tools like a caulk gun and a putty knife, a glasscutter, a cordless tool, and a utility knife.

Some homeowners use window guards, security bars, or grilles that block windows, but they are not very effective in an emergency. Install ASTM F2090-compliant devices that restrict the opening of windows, or windows equipped with quick release mechanisms that are able to be opened when the home is locked. They should also teach their children about window safety and develop an escape plan that includes specific windows can be used in an emergency.
